Jones & Company is a well-established CPA firm known for providing comprehensive accounting, tax, and advisory services to a diverse clientele. Our commitment to excellence and integrity has earned us a reputation for delivering high‑quality services and building long‑term client relationships. We are currently seeking an experienced and detail‑oriented Senior Tax Reviewer to join our team.
Key Responsibilities- Review and ensure the accuracy and completeness of individual, corporate, partnership, and fiduciary tax returns.
- Provide technical guidance and support to junior tax staff and ensure compliance with tax laws and regulations.
- Conduct thorough research on complex tax issues and provide recommendations to clients and staff.
- Collaborate with clients to gather necessary information and resolve tax‑related issues.
- Prepare tax projections and estimates for clients.
- Maintain up‑to‑date knowledge of tax laws and industry trends.
- Assist in the development and implementation of tax planning strategies.
- Ensure timely and accurate filing of all tax returns and extensions.
- Manage multiple client engagements and deliver high‑quality service within deadlines.
- Identify opportunities for process improvements and contribute to the enhancement of firm‑wide tax practices.
- CPA certification, preferred.
-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field;
Master’s degree in Taxation preferred. - Minimum of 4 years of experience in tax preparation and review, preferably in a CPA firm.
- Strong knowledge of federal, state, and local tax laws and regulations.
- Excellent analytical, organizational, and problem‑solving skills.
Strong communication and interpersonal skills. - Proficiency in tax software and Microsoft Office Suite.
- Attention to detail and ability to work independently and as part of a team, managing multiple priorities and meeting deadlines.
